How does AI Phone Ordering cut Labor Costs for Fast‑Casual restaurants?

Wages are the fastest-growing expense for restaurant operators. The BLS Restaurant Industry Labor Statistics report a 12% jump in average hourly pay over three years. Add overtime premiums, constant training, and high turnover, and Labor quickly eats into margins.

AI Phone Ordering eliminates the need to staff a dedicated call taker on every shift. It answers calls, records order details, confirms specials, and suggests add-ons that increase the average ticket. Since it runs nonstop, you swap out a $15/hour employee for a subscription costing far less.

Replacing a human order taker with AI can save about $12,000 annually per location. Here’s the math: a full-time employee Costs roughly $31,200 per year (40 hours × $15 × 52 weeks). StrideQ’s subscription, including support and analytics, runs around $19,200 annually.

Plus, you slash training time. New hires typically spend up to two weeks mastering Phone etiquette, menu details, and POS integration. AI takes that burden off managers, letting them focus on food safety and speeding up service instead.

How can you calculate the ROI of AI Phone Ordering?

ROI breaks down to (Net Savings ÷ Investment) × 100. Here’s a stepwise approach:

  1. Check average daily Phone orders per location.
  2. Compute current monthly Labor cost: (hours per shift × hourly wage × shifts per week × 52 weeks) ÷ 12.
  3. Identify your StrideQ subscription cost.
  4. Estimate monthly upsell revenue: average upsell per order × daily orders × 30.
  5. Subtract subscription from Labor saved, then add upsell revenue.
  6. Apply the formula with net gain and subscription cost.

For example, a store with 150 daily orders:

  • Current Labor: approx. $2,600/month (40 hours × $15 × 52 ÷ 12)
  • StrideQ subscription: $1,200/month
  • Labor saved: $1,400/month
  • Upsell gain: $1.10 × 150 × 30 ≈ $4,950/month
  • Net gain: $1,400 + $4,950 = $6,350/month
  • ROI: ($6,350 ÷ $1,200) × 100 ≈ 529%

That 529% ROI means the system pays for itself in just under three weeks.

What are the common pitfalls and how can you avoid them?

Even well-planned rollouts stumble on a few details:

  • Underestimating call volume. Launching a low-volume location (e.g., 60 calls/day) drastically cuts ROI. Use your audit to pick viable sites.
  • Ignoring menu updates. If your menu gets stale, the bot will recommend unavailable items, frustrating customers. Schedule weekly menu syncs with StrideQ.
  • Not gathering staff feedback. Kitchen teams catch routing errors early. Hold a quick weekly huddle after launch to collect issues.
  • Failing to promote the new channel. Customers won’t use what they don’t know exists. Add “Call 555‑1234 for instant AI Ordering” on your site and in-store signage.

Catching these problems early keeps savings on track and maintains customer satisfaction.

Best practices to maximize upsell revenue and order accuracy

Upsells work best when relevant and concise:

  • Use specific offers: Rather than “Want fries?” Try “Make it a combo with chips and a drink for $2.49.” Anchoring price boosts acceptance.
  • Don’t overdo it: One upsell prompt per order keeps calls quick and customers happy.
  • Time offers right: Suggest add-ons after the main entree is confirmed, not before.
  • Promote specials: Limited-time deals convert better. Program the AI to highlight those first.
  • Measure results: Use StrideQ’s A/B testing to refine phrasing. Even a 1–2% lift in upsell rate adds up.

Sample upsell phrasing: “Great choice — would you like to add our house-made chips and a drink for just $2.49 to make it a combo?”
